The Homoerotics of Early Modern Drama - Cambridge Studies in Renaissance Literature and Culture DiGangi, Mario (Indiana University)
The Homoerotics of Early Modern Drama - Cambridge Studies in Renaissance Literature and Culture
DiGangi, Mario (Indiana University)
Mario DiGangi analyses the relation between homoeroticism and social power in a wide range of literary and historical texts from the 1580s to the 1620s, drawing on the insights of materialist, feminist and queer theory.
